Subject: Flaky DNS in relay tests

Reviewer: the Fenwick relay suite fails intermittently on resolution timeouts against the staging resolver. Not your change — it reproduces on main. Retry logic masks it locally but CI caches cold lookups. I've bumped the resolver timeout and pinned the stub zone. Please approve the mitigation patch today. The failing build's trace token follows.

pipeline stamp: htk31_f769b577b3028a4e9958e5bb8d1259a

HANDOVER NOTE — from Dorrit to Malin, cc office manager

Malin, before I'm out next week: the full set of stamped blueprints for the Larkspur Annexe building permit is in the flat-file cabinet, drawer three, in a grey tube marked "Permit Set — Final." The planning office at Westhollow needs the originals, not copies, by Wednesday. A courier slot is already booked for Tuesday afternoon; the tube must stay sealed in transit. Brief the courier with the hand-over instruction below.

dispatch memo: the lamwyn fenwyn courier leaves the wenir ledger at gate 7175 under passcode 822969

**Q: Bounces aren't being processed — what now?**

The Mailsift bounce processor polls the Driftbox queue every two minutes. If bounces pile up, check the processor heartbeat on the Corvane status page first. Stale heartbeat: restart the worker. Fresh heartbeat but no throughput: likely a malformed bounce payload jamming the parser. For parser jams, escalate to the deliverability rotation.

pager mailbox: druwyn@norvaio.corp